Support for Families
We provide parents and carers with free, time-limited outreach and practical advice designed to foster stability and child wellbeing.
Our Family Outreach Programme serves parents and carers in Kent by offering dedicated, time-limited early help to ensure children thrive both at home and in school. We provide a bridge to essential resources, fostering stability and child wellbeing through proactive, person-centered support.

Attendance Support
Professional Development
We work directly with families to improve school engagement and attendance through tailored routines and emotional wellbeing support.
As an approved CPD provider, we offer specialized training for DSLs and attendance leads to strengthen safeguarding and early intervention.
Family Outreach
Our trained volunteers provide free, time-limited support to families, focusing on positive parenting and early safeguarding concerns.
